The Certified Specialist Programme in Robotics Redundancy provides in-depth knowledge and practical skills in designing, implementing, and maintaining robust robotic systems. This specialized training focuses on mitigating failures through redundancy strategies, enhancing overall system reliability and resilience.
Learning outcomes include a comprehensive understanding of various redundancy techniques applicable to robotic architectures, fault tolerance analysis, and the development of self-healing mechanisms. Participants will gain proficiency in implementing and testing redundant robotic systems using simulation and real-world scenarios. The program also covers advanced topics in control systems and sensor fusion, crucial for effective redundancy management.
